**Vendor note: Inkmill markdown pipeline**

Rendering for Parchway docs is outsourced to Inkmill under an annual contract, renewing each March. They handle sanitization and PDF export; we own the upload queue. SLA: 4-hour response on rendering failures. Escalate only after two failed retries. Their support desk is reachable at the address below.

billing contact of hahaf-baguf = zorael.tammir.jorius@sivrelhq.internal

**Ticket: Signature verification failed on Corelight UI v3.8.1**

The Corelight shared component library failed its signature check during the nightly publish. Root cause: the version bump script re-tagged v3.8.1 after signing, invalidating the digest. Fix is to sign after tagging, never before. For reviewers validating the corrected pipeline, the key used to re-sign the release is below.

signing key of bagap-yawep = bky13_TbfT6ZMUoGJo2

Runbook: Pipewing telemetry compression. When ingest queues on the Quellmar cluster back up, enable zstd compression on outbound telemetry payloads before restarting the collectors. Set TELEM_COMPRESSION=zstd and TELEM_CHUNK_KB=256 in the collector's env file, then verify payload sizes drop in the Haldrey dashboard. The compressor also needs the signing secret for batch headers, so add the following line to the env file.

env line for fawip-fajef: COURIER_KEY13=6b302cb20dc80

### Audit Item 14: Catalogue Import — Brindlemoor Library

Verify the Shelfwright catalogue import completed without duplicate accession records. Confirm: row counts match source extract; rejected rows logged and reviewed; ISBN normalization applied; rollback snapshot retained for 30 days. Import must not run during circulation hours. Any variance over 0.5% blocks release. Evidence goes in the audit binder before the go/no-go call. Sign-off for this item rests with a single accountable owner.

approver of yawig-yajef = Briius Jorix